16-Year-Old Fatally Shot by Deputy in Walmart Shoplifting Incident

POINCIANA, FL — The Osceola County Sheriff’s Office provided a further update Friday on the officer-involved shooting that took place Thursday night at a Walmart store in Poinciana.

Detectives have identified and accounted for the two male subjects who were with the deceased suspect during the incident. One is a juvenile, and the other is an adult in his twenties.

The two males have not been arrested. No charges have been filed against these two individuals.

The Florida Department of Law Enforcement (FDLE) continues to investigate the officer-involved shooting. Sheriff’s officials stated they are not far enough into the investigation to speculate about the involvement of the two males or any potential charges. If circumstances change, an update will be provided.

As previously noted, the suspect who was shot and killed is a juvenile who turned 16 years old on December 30, 2025, and resided in Poinciana.

Due to the ongoing FDLE investigation, the Osceola County Sheriff’s Office will not release additional information at this time, including Walmart surveillance video. Body-worn camera footage and other public records will be released once FDLE reaches an appropriate stage in the investigation. The incident remains under active review by FDLE.

According to OCSO, the incident unfolded around 7:45 p.m. at the Walmart located at 904 Cypress Parkway in Poinciana when Walmart’s loss prevention officer alerted the deputy that three males had concealed merchandise in their clothing and were heading toward the store exit without paying.

The deputy confronted the suspects, who then attempted to flee. One of the males produced a handgun and, while running, approached other customers in the store. In response to the immediate threat posed by the armed suspect, the deputy fired his weapon, striking the individual. The suspect was pronounced deceased at the scene.


02/21Update: The name of the suspect that died at the Walmart on 2/19 is Jairus Eroge Jones (DOB 12/30/2009).
